Do you want a taste of college life? Adelphi’s Summer Pre-College Program will take place July 12-August 1, 2026.

Adelphi’s Pre-College Program offers high school students an early college experience through multiple program options. Open to rising sophomores, juniors, and seniors, our programs give students the chance to preview college life—taking classes, attending lectures and seminars, connecting with peers and professors, and engaging in college-readiness activities.

Why Join Adelphi’s Pre-College Summer Program in New York?

Adelphi’s Summer Pre-College programs—ranked among the top 30 in the nation by College Consensus—offer high school students credit-bearing courses, noncredit academies, and residential experiences on our Garden City campus.

Our credit-bearing summer college program allows you to walk away with three transferable college credits. It’s a great introduction to the hands-on, high-impact learning at Adelphi, and an unforgettable growing experience. While our non-credit summer academies give students the chance to explore careers, develop practical skills, earn certifications, and gain real-world experience in a fast-paced, immersive week on campus.

Enrolling in a pre-college program offers a number of benefits. You can gain exposure to college life and engage in classroom experiences that can help in choosing a major. You can also gain valuable, early experience in critical thinking, research and presentation skills.

The one-week Academies are short, non-credit, hands-on experiences that let students explore potential majors and career paths in an engaging, low-pressure setting. They’re ideal for students who want to test the waters or fit a program into a busy summer schedule.

By contrast, the three-week Pre-College programs are credit-bearing courses that provide a deeper academic experience—students complete college-level coursework, earn three transferable Adelphi credits, and experience both academic and residential life on campus.

  • Rising high school sophomores, juniors and seniors are eligible to participate in our credit-bearing courses.
  • Rising high school freshmen, sophomores, juniors and seniors are eligible to participate in non-credit academies.

The following stipulations apply to international pre-college applicants:

  • If you already have an F-1 visa and are studying in the U.S., you can join the Pre-College Program during the summer.
  • If you are in the U.S. on a tourist visa, you may also take part in the program as a recreational or short-term activity.
  • If you are outside the U.S., please contact your local U.S. Embassy or Consulate to find out what travel documents you’ll need.

Adelphi University cannot issue an I-20 form for this program.

Adelphi University requires all non-native English speakers to take and pass one of several available proficiency exams. You can submit your TOEFL, IELTS, or Duolingo English Test (DET) results to precollege@adelphi.edu.

Because the program schedules overlap, students must choose one program per summer. Many students take part in different years—for example, attending a one-week academy one summer and returning for a three-week pre-college course the next.

Yes. Students who complete any of Adelphi’s Pre-College programs can receive the Adelphi Advantage Award—a $1,000 annual scholarship that can be combined with other awards.
